diff options
author | Christopher Faylor <me@cgf.cx> | 2004-01-22 19:03:19 +0000 |
---|---|---|
committer | Christopher Faylor <me@cgf.cx> | 2004-01-22 19:03:19 +0000 |
commit | 39d06d71ff60e2c65b678e41b004e00c262c938b (patch) | |
tree | 481af3287dc0d9a44d505a3e7bce03dc105976b3 /winsup/cygwin/ChangeLog | |
parent | 537ca63f8e95a1f4f0c71e40c64c09cdbb0b74bd (diff) | |
download | cygnal-39d06d71ff60e2c65b678e41b004e00c262c938b.tar.gz cygnal-39d06d71ff60e2c65b678e41b004e00c262c938b.tar.bz2 cygnal-39d06d71ff60e2c65b678e41b004e00c262c938b.zip |
* cygtls.cc (_threadinfo::remove): Don't assume that we are removing _my_tls.
* exceptions.cc (setup_handler): Improve debugging output.
(call_signal_handler_now): Remove ill-advised debugger call.
* sigproc.cc (sigcomplete_main): Delete.
(sig_send): Honor FIXME and avoid using main thread's completion event for
everything or suffer races.
(pending_signals::add): Default stored mask to current process mask rather than
mask at time of signal send.
(wait_sig): Add debugging output.
* sigproc.h (sigpacket::mask_storage): Delete.
Diffstat (limited to 'winsup/cygwin/ChangeLog')
-rw-r--r-- | winsup/cygwin/ChangeLog |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/winsup/cygwin/ChangeLog b/winsup/cygwin/ChangeLog index 85a848941..07d199ffc 100644 --- a/winsup/cygwin/ChangeLog +++ b/winsup/cygwin/ChangeLog @@ -1,5 +1,19 @@ 2004-01-22 Christopher Faylor <cgf@redhat.com> + * cygtls.cc (_threadinfo::remove): Don't assume that we are removing + _my_tls. + * exceptions.cc (setup_handler): Improve debugging output. + (call_signal_handler_now): Remove ill-advised debugger call. + * sigproc.cc (sigcomplete_main): Delete. + (sig_send): Honor FIXME and avoid using main thread's completion event + for everything or suffer races. + (pending_signals::add): Default stored mask to current process mask + rather than mask at time of signal send. + (wait_sig): Add debugging output. + * sigproc.h (sigpacket::mask_storage): Delete. + +2004-01-22 Christopher Faylor <cgf@redhat.com> + * fhandler.cc (fhandler_base::open): Revert isfs change. 2004-01-21 Christopher Faylor <cgf@redhat.com> |